在使用CRUD界面的morphia模型的一般保存操作期间,我收到以下错误:
糟糕:NullPointerException由于引起意外错误 异常NullPointerException:null
play.exceptions.UnexpectedException:意外错误 play.modules.morphia.Model.edit(Model.java:219)at play.modules.morphia.MorphiaPlugin.bind(MorphiaPlugin.java:607) ...
我发现类似的错误发生在1.2.4a版本中并在1.2.4b中修复。 我对最新版本的morphia进行了下载。在app开始我收到followind日志:
12:18:59,036 INFO~模块morphia可用(C:\ play-1.2.4 \ samples-and-tests \ test1 \ modules \ morphia-1.2.4b )
12:18:59,037 INFO~模块安全可用(C:\ play-1.2.4 \ modules \ secure)
12:18:59,978警告〜你正在玩Play!在DEV模式下
12:19:00,110 INFO~在端口9000上侦听HTTP(等待第一个请求开始)...
12:19:11,680 INFO~连接到jdbc:mysql:// localhost / test1?useUnicode = yes& characterEncoding = UTF-8& connectionCollation = utf8_general_ci
12:19:14,869 INFO~ MorphiaPlugin-1.2.4a >初始化
所以,现在我无法了解我实际使用的morphia版本,并且无法理解如何修复错误。
请给我一些关于我的问题的建议。
答案 0 :(得分:1)
我遇到了问题,在这一天,morphia无法使用play 1.2.4
crud模块。您必须回滚到1.2.3
。